What Makes a City Liveable? Unpacking the Criteria

Several organizations, like the Economist Intelligence Unit (EIU) and Mercer, release annual rankings of the world's most liveable cities. These rankings consider a wide range of factors, typically grouped into categories like:

  • Stability: Crime rates, political stability, and the threat of conflict.
  • Healthcare: Quality and accessibility of healthcare services.
  • Culture and Environment: Availability of cultural attractions, recreational activities, and environmental quality (air and water quality).
  • Education: Quality of educational institutions.
  • Infrastructure: Quality of roads, public transportation, and utilities.

⚖️ Weighing the Factors: Subjectivity Matters

It's important to remember that liveability is somewhat subjective. What one person values in a city might be different from another. For example, someone who loves the outdoors might prioritize access to parks and green spaces, while someone else might prioritize a vibrant nightlife and cultural scene. Spotlight on Top Cities: What Makes Them Shine?

Let's take a closer look at some cities that consistently rank high in liveability surveys:

🇦🇺 Melbourne, Australia

Often topping the list, Melbourne boasts a strong economy, excellent healthcare, a thriving arts and culture scene, and top-notch education. It also has a well-developed infrastructure and a relatively low crime rate.

🇦🇹 Vienna, Austria

Vienna consistently ranks high due to its exceptional public transportation, affordable housing, excellent healthcare system, and rich cultural heritage. The city is also known for its cleanliness and safety.

🇨🇦 Vancouver, Canada

Surrounded by stunning natural beauty, Vancouver offers a high quality of life with its clean air, access to outdoor activities, and strong economy. It also has a diverse and welcoming community.

🇨🇦 Calgary, Canada

Calgary offers a balance of economic opportunity and quality of life, with a relatively affordable housing market compared to other major Canadian cities. It also has a strong job market, particularly in the energy sector, and access to the Rocky Mountains.

🇩🇪 Hamburg, Germany

Hamburg, a port city in northern Germany, offers a high quality of life with a strong economy, excellent infrastructure, and a vibrant cultural scene. It's known for its maritime heritage, stunning architecture, and numerous canals and waterways.

Cost of Living: Balancing Liveability with Affordability

Liveability often comes at a price. Cities with high quality of life can also have a high cost of living. It's crucial to research the cost of housing, transportation, food, and other expenses before making a move.

💰 Budget Breakdown Example (Monthly):

Expense Vienna (EUR) Vancouver (CAD)
Rent (1-bedroom apartment) 900 - 1300 1800 - 2500
Utilities 150 200
Groceries 400 500
Transportation 75 (monthly pass) 100 (monthly pass)

Factors to Consider Before Making a Move

Moving to a new city is a significant decision. Consider these factors before packing your bags:

  1. Job Market: Research job opportunities in your field.
  2. Climate: Can you handle the weather?
  3. Culture: Will you feel comfortable in the local culture?
  4. Language: Do you speak the local language?
  5. Visa Requirements: Understand the immigration process.

Sustainable Urban Planning and Liveability

Sustainability is becoming increasingly important for liveability. Cities that prioritize environmental protection, renewable energy, and green spaces are more attractive to residents and businesses alike. Sustainable urban planning considers how to reduce carbon footprint, promote biodiversity, and improve the overall quality of life for present and future generations. The Role of Technology in Enhancing Urban Liveability

Technology plays a pivotal role in shaping the liveability of cities. Smart city initiatives leverage data and connectivity to improve infrastructure, transportation, public safety, and resource management. For example, intelligent transportation systems can optimize traffic flow and reduce congestion, while smart grids can enhance energy efficiency and reliability. Furthermore, digital platforms can provide residents with access to information, services, and opportunities, fostering greater civic engagement and social inclusion.

💡 Smart City Examples:

  • Smart Transportation: Real-time traffic updates, ride-sharing programs, and electric vehicle infrastructure.
  • Smart Energy: Renewable energy sources, energy-efficient buildings, and smart grids.
  • Smart Governance: Online portals for accessing government services and citizen engagement platforms.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: What are the most important factors in determining a city's liveability?

A: Stability, healthcare, culture and environment, education, and infrastructure are generally considered the most important factors.

Q: How do different ranking organizations measure liveability?

A: Organizations like the EIU and Mercer use different methodologies and weight different factors differently, so their rankings can vary.

Q: Is a high-ranking liveable city always the best choice for everyone?

A: No, liveability is subjective, and the best city for you will depend on your individual needs and preferences.

Q: How can I research the cost of living in a particular city?

A: Websites like Numbeo and Expatistan provide cost of living data for cities around the world.
